H-1B sponsorship profile: Reed City Hospital Corporation.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, Reed City Hospital Corporation filed 1 Labor Condition Applications covering 1 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2024 and fiscal year 2024.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 100% (1 certified of 1 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.
Compensation spread. Offered wages on Reed City Hospital Corporation’s H-1B petitions range from $48,318 at the low end to $48,318 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$48,318.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Medical Laboratory Technologist/Scientist (1 petitions at $48,318 avg). H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.
Geographic footprint. Reed City Hospital Corporation is headquartered in Grand Rapids, MI under NAICS code 622110, and places H-1B workers across 1 state, most heavily in MI.
